Jim Ryun a former Representative from Kansas: born in Wichita, Sedgewick County, KS. April 29, 1947; graduated from Wichita East High School, Wichita, KS., 1965. B.A., University of Kansas in Photojournalism, Lawrence, KS., 1970; President, Jim Ryun Sports, Inc.; Silver Medalist, Olympic Games, 1968; product consultant; motivational speaker. Elected as a Republican to the One Hundred Fifth Congress; became a member of the One Hundred Fourth Congress under the provisions of Kansas State Law (k.s.a. 25-3503) on November 27, 1996, re-elected to the One Hundred Sixth Congress and to the three succeeding Congress (November 27, 1996-January 3, 2007).
